Sažetak
In this paper we introduce machine-job incidence (MJI) matrix that can be obtained from Steward sequencing matrix and Kusiak machine-part incidence matrix. Methods for determination of structural properties of the system are proposed and an explanation on how the content (number of active jobs) of those structures can be controlled is given. Furthermore, the paper presents new methods on how to allocate jobs to resources and how to allocate resources to jobs. Although efficiency of the proposed methods have been demonstrated on examples involving manufacturing workcells, the method can be used for other discrete event systems as well, as long as the system under study belongs to free-choice multiple reentrant flowlines class.
